  • Your opportunity
  • Detection & Response
  • Act as a senior escalation point for complex/high‑severity alerts across SIEM, EDR, Cloud and Identity platforms.
  • Lead end‑to‑end incident response (investigation, containment, eradication, and post‑incident review).
  • Coordinate immediate mitigation actions across infrastructure, network, and legal teams to isolate compromised environments, stop data exfiltration, and minimize downtime.
  • Define and drive the strategic direction for incident response services, ensuring they align with emerging threats.
  • Build, develop and oversee cyber security playbooks.
  • Correlate alerts with threat intelligence and business context to assess risk and impact.
  • Produce clear investigation summaries for technical and non‑technical stakeholders.
  • Identify potential security risks and document clear, actionable remediation options or mitigating controls aligned with industry best practices.
  • Support preservation of digital evidence and coordinate with Incident Response Retainer for forensic collection.
  • Support day‑to‑day security operations and business inquiries.
  • Threat Hunting & Proactive Detection
  • Conduct proactive threat hunting using queries, dashboards and behavioral analytics.
  • Identify gaps using frameworks such as MITRE ATT&CK and translate findings into improved detections and playbooks.
  • Tune alerts and detections to reduce noise while maintaining coverage.
  • Validate and manage exclusions with clear risk assessment and documentation.
  • Work with Detection Engineering to enhance detection logic and alert quality.
  • AI‑Assisted Investigation & Tooling
  • Use AI-enabled features across SOC tooling to accelerate analysis and investigations.
  • Initiate improvements to tooling, workflows, and AI effectiveness.
  • Support development of safe and consistent AI usage standards within the SOC.
  • Collaboration & Mentoring
  • Mentor junior analysts and support their development.
  • Provide leadership during incidents and contribute to continuous SOC improvement.
  • Collaborate with Security Engineering to support automation and security tooling.
  • Collaborate with stakeholders and support partnerships with internal teams and external vendors to improve vulnerability remediation.
  • Provide regional handovers to ensure continuity and adherence to operational standards across regions.
  • Assist in incorporating regulatory compliance requirements such as SOX and GLBA into the organization’s security roadmap.
